“High school is like a free trial on education” (college joke)

High school is usually free (paid by government taxes); college is usually very expensive. “High school is like a free trial. It’s cool and all but most of the fun stuff is locked unless you buy the full version…COLLEGE” was posted on Twitter by Tyler on August 29, 2012. “‘@Willy_TheSquid: High school is like a free-trial for college. ‘If u wish to continue ur education u can buy the complete pack for $60,000’” was posted on Twitter on August 30, 2013.
 
”’@Ivan_splash: High school is like a free trial on education and then once you’ve graduated they say ‘now if you wanna continue pay $50,000’” was posted on Twitter on January 12, 2014. “High school is like a free trial on education. Once you’ve graduated, they say ‘now if you want to continue, pay $50,000’” was posted on Reddit—Shower Thoughts on September 17, 2014.
   
The saying has been printed on several images.
